59. The angle of a prism is ’ A ’. One of its refracting surfaces is silvered. Light rays falling at an angle of incidence 2 A on the first surface returns back through the same path after suffering reflection at the silvered surface. The refractive index μ, of the prism is :



(a) \(2\sin A\)

(b) \(2\cos A\)

(c) \(\tfrac12\cos A\)

(d) \(\tan A\)


Answer :  (b) \(2\cos A\)











\(\frac{\sin i}{\sin r} = \mu\)


\(\frac{\sin 2A}{\sin A} = \mu\)


\(\frac{2 \sin A \cos A}{\sin A} = \mu\)


\(2 \cos A = \mu\)
